Since my house was build in 1870 and Portland … Web31 aug. 2024 · Type O mortar, or high-lime mortar, a softer mortar with a low compressive strength of 350 psi, is best suited to repointing for several reasons. The first reason is that type O mortar is softer than the older bricks, and it allows the bricks to expand or contract from temperature changes or stress. Can pointing cause a leak?

WebRepoint only when temperatures remain between 40 and 90 degrees Fahrenheit, even at night. Cold makes mortar brittle, while heat dries it out and prevents hardening. Web9 mrt. 2024 · It is surprising just how many simple clues there are which tell you it’s time to repoint your wall. As well as the visual clues pointed out (no pun intended) above, try running your finger along the mortar in-between the bricks. If it crumbles away easily, this is a strong sign that some maintenance work needs doing. WebStage 1. Raking out and removal of old or inappropriate mortar to a minimum depth of 25-40 mm or until sound mortar. Depth of the joint is relative to the width between stones. As a guide, joints should be raked out to twice the width of the joint – so a 1cm wide joint should be raked out to at least 2 cm, preferably 2.5 cm.

Web29 okt. 2024 · The mortar for repointing needs to be softer and also a lot more porous than the blocks. Making use of a mortar kind with a stronger compressive toughness than the brick triggers cracking and also spalling. Several residences built before 1930 made use of all-natural hydraulic lime mortar as well as softer bricks. Web29 okt. 2024 · Minimum set you back$ 30. Optimum cost$ 3,000.
